Greystar Reaches Deal in US Justice Department’s Rental Market Collusion Case
Greystar Real Estate Partners LLC reached a tentative settlement with the Department of Justice in an antitrust lawsuit accusing the landlord of colluding to increase rents across the US, in part, through widely used industry software.
As part of the deal, Greystar is barred from generating pricing recommendations derived from algorithms using competitively sensitive data, sharing competitive information with competitors and must cooperate in the government’s case against the rental market software and data company RealPage Inc.
